This item consists of 11 typed pages, numbered 43 - 53, and 3 handwritten pages, with editing and additions. The pages from Item 1 have been incorporated. New themes introduced are OR Tambo and issues around his successor, the roles of Jakes Gerwel and Joel Netshitenzhe, Frene Ginwala as speaker of the National Assembly, and the position of women in the cabinet. Three handwritten pages on OR Tambo and Cyril Ramaphosa, quoting from F. W. de Klerk’s autobiography, are added.

    Chapter 4 The National Chairperson Oliver Reginald Tambo, fondly referred to as OR by his comrades, a humble but brilliant lawyer and devout Christian, who became head of the ANC when Chief Luthuli passed away, was also a skilful and respected leader, who raised the organisation to a position of strength and influence it had never reached before. * He was a hard and diligent worker who never spared himself, and who literally was on duty twenty-four hours a day throughout the year without taking any holiday. His wife, Adelaide, tells the story of how OR once worked throughout the night. When he saw her dressed and leaving the house, he asked where she was going to at night. It was probably this heavy schedule which contributed to the breakdown of his health. He suffered a stroke which left him partially paralysed. The officials discussed his position, and were all keen that he should make his enormous wisdom and experience available formally to the organisation. We accordingly appointed him National Chairperson, a position he held until his death in 1993. 43
